Praise Awaits You Song Meaning, Biblical Reference and Inspiration

Praise Awaits You by Matt Redman is a powerful worship song that calls believers to gather together and lift up praises to the Lord.

Introduction to Praise Awaits You

Praise Awaits You is a song that encourages believers to come together in unity and sing praises to God. The song begins with the line, "Praise awaits You in this place today, O Lord." This sets the tone for the entire song, as it acknowledges that praise is a natural response to the greatness of God.

The Key Messages of Praise Awaits You

1. Praise as a Response to God's Glory

The song emphasizes that praise is a response to the glory of God. The lyrics state, "We are gathered, ready, God, to sing Your praise, ready to respond to the glories of Your name, to the wonders of Your heart." Here, the focus is on the greatness of God's name and His heart. It reminds believers that God is deserving of all praise and worship.

2. The Power of God's Love

Another key message in the song is the power of God's love. The lyrics state, "To Your great love." This line highlights the unconditional and unfailing love that God has for His people. It serves as a reminder that God's love is the foundation of our praise and worship.

3. The Anticipation of God's Presence

The song also expresses a sense of anticipation for God's presence. The line, "Praise is waiting for You in this place," suggests that believers are eagerly waiting for God to manifest His presence among them. It conveys the expectation and excitement that comes with experiencing God's presence during worship.

4. Worship as a Corporate Act

Praise Awaits You encourages believers to gather together and worship as a community. The song acknowledges that praise is not meant to be done in isolation but is a communal act. The line, "We are gathered, ready, God, to sing Your praise," emphasizes the importance of coming together as a body of believers to worship God.

The Meaning and Inspiration Behind Praise Awaits You

The meaning of Praise Awaits You is rooted in the biblical concept of worship. It encourages believers to recognize and respond to the greatness of God through praise and worship. The inspiration for the song likely comes from Psalm 95:1-2, which says, "Come, let us sing for joy to the Lord; let us shout aloud to the Rock of our salvation. Let us come before him with thanksgiving and extol him with music and song."

Matt Redman, the songwriter behind Praise Awaits You, has a long history of writing songs that lead people into worship. His desire is to create music that glorifies God and draws people closer to Him. Praise Awaits You is a reflection of this desire, as it encourages believers to gather together and lift up praises to God.

Is Praise Awaits You Biblical?

To determine if Praise Awaits You is biblical, we need to examine its lyrics in light of scriptural principles. The song's main messages align with biblical teachings on praise and worship. The Bible repeatedly calls believers to praise and worship God, recognizing His greatness and responding to His love. Here are a few biblical references that support the themes found in Praise Awaits You:

1. Psalm 95:1-2 - "Come, let us sing for joy to the Lord; let us shout aloud to the Rock of our salvation. Let us come before him with thanksgiving and extol him with music and song."

2. Psalm 150:1-6 - "Praise the Lord. Praise God in his sanctuary; praise him in his mighty heavens. Praise him for his acts of power; praise him for his surpassing greatness. Praise him with the sounding of the trumpet, praise him with the harp and lyre, praise him with timbrel and dancing, praise him with the strings and pipe, praise him with the clash of cymbals, praise him with resounding cymbals. Let everything that has breath praise the Lord. Praise the Lord."

3. Ephesians 5:19-20 - "Speaking to one another with psalms, hymns, and songs from the Spirit. Sing and make music from your heart to the Lord, always giving thanks to God the Father for everything, in the name of our Lord Jesus Christ."

Based on these biblical references, it is clear that the themes and messages found in Praise Awaits You align with the principles of praise and worship outlined in the Bible.
